Water Distribution System Handbook--------------------------------------------------All-in-one, state-of-the-art guide to safe drinking water Civil engineersand anyone else involved in any way with the design, analysis, operation,maintenance or rehabilitation of water distribution systems will findpractical guidance in Water Distribution Systems Handbook. Expertsselected by Handbook editor Larry W. Mays provide historical, presentday, and future perspectives, as well as state-of-the-art details previouslyavailable only in specialized journals. You get a comprehensively detailedexploration of every facet of the hydraulics of pressurized flow, pipingdesign and pipeline systems, storage issues, reliability analysis anddistribution, and more. Detailed information on the latest technologycontributions and on enhancements to the EPANET model are included.You'll also find case studies that range from the small municipal systemsfound in every U.S. town, to large systems common to great urban centerslike New York, London and Paris.--------------------------------------------------Author Biography: Larry W. Mays is professor of civil and environmentalengineering at Arizona State University and former chair of the department.He was formerly director of the Center for Research in Water Resourcesat the University of Texas at Austin, where he also held an EngineeringFoundation Endowed Professorship. A registered professional engineerin seven states and a registered professional hydrologist, he has servedas consultant to many organizations. A widely published expert onwater resources, he wrote Optimal Control of Hydrosystems (Marcel Dekker)and was editor in chief of both Water Resources Handbook (McGraw-Hill)and Hydraulic Design Handbook (McGraw-Hill). Co-author of both AppliedHydrology and Hydrosystems Engineering and Management published byMcGraw-Hill, and was the editor in chief of Reliability Analysis ofWater Distribution Systems (ASCE), and co-editor of Computer Modelingof Free-Surface and Pressurized Flows (Kluwer Academic Publishers).He has published extensively on his research in water resources management.
